Keith Earl Wykle, 52, of 154 Long Creek Drive, was arrested after the collisions, said Lance Cpl. Jeff Gaskin with the S.C. Highway Patrol.
The first collision occurred at 8:28 a.m. Wednesday as Wykle was traveling eastbound on S.C. 124 in a 1993 Ford Crown Victoria, Gaskin said.
Wykle’s car struck a 2005 moped driven by
Greenville resident Glenn Otto, Gaskin said.
Otto was thrown from the moped and injured in the collision, Gaskin said.
He was transported to Greenville Memorial Hospital, he said. Otto was not wearing a helmet.
Wykle is accused of then fleeing the scene, only to collide with another vehicle, a 1999 Subaru, driven by Greenville resident Ethel Hall, Gaskin said.
Hall and a passenger in her vehicle were taken to GMH for treatment of injuries.
Wykle was injured in the collisions and was also transported to GMH for treatment.
The Highway Patrol is still investigating the accident, Gaskin said.
